What is CME Group's shares (diluted)?
CME Group (CME) reported shares (diluted) of 363.2M in Q1 2026.
How has CME Group's shares (diluted) changed year-over-year?
CME Group's shares (diluted) increased by 0.8% year-over-year, from 360.2M to 363.2M.

What does shares (diluted) mean?
The weighted-average shares outstanding plus all potentially dilutive shares from stock options, RSUs, convertible securities, and warrants, using the treasury stock method.
